Individual Human Cell Populations Detected using HemoLIGHT™-96
(see Lympho-Hematopoietic System to view cell populations and growth factor/cytokine cocktails)
The following proliferation status or potential can be detected for individual populations using HemoLIGHT™-96:
Stem Cells
- HPP-SP 2: EPO, GM-CSF, IL-2, IL-3, Il-6, IL-7, SCF, TPO, Flt3-L
- CFC-GEMM 1: EPO, GM-CSF, IL-3, IL-6, SCF, TPO, Flt3-L
- CFC-GEM 1: EPO, GM-CSF, IL-3, IL-6, SCF
- CFC-GEM 2: EPO, GM-CSF, IL-3, SCF
Progenitor Cells
- BFU-E 1: EPO, IL-3, SCF
- GM-CFC 1: GM-CSF, IL-3, SCF
- Mk-CFC 1: TPO, IL-3, SCF
No growth factors: Add growth factors/cytokines of choice.

The HemoLIGHT™-96 Principle
- Incorporates a customized Promega CellTiter 96® AQueous One reagent that measures the amount of soluble formazan by absorbance at 490nm produced by a MTS tetrazolium reduction, colorimetric reaction.
- After culture, just add 20μl of the MTS reagent, mix and read absorbance at 490nm after 1-4 hours in a 96-well plate reader. Plates can be returned to incubator and re-read at a later time for increased sensitivity.
- No solubilization step as in a MTT reaction. Replaces MTT assays.
- Read results between 1-4 hours after addition of MTS reagent. Plates can be returned to incubator and re-read at a later time for increased sensitivity.

HemoLIGHT™-96 PCAEQ is used as an Alternative to or Replacement for CAMEO™-4
(using the same reagent) and MethoCult® (using the same growth factor cocktails)
The table below shows the HemoLIGHT™-96 PCAEQ assays that are equivalent to CAMEO™-4 assays and MethoCult® reagents used in the stem cell processing laboratory. The growth factor/cytokine cocktail is the same for all three.
CAMEO™-4 and HemoLIGHT™-96 PCAEQ Assays that are Equivalent to MethoCult® Reagents
| CAMEO™-4 |
HemoLIGHT™-96 PCAEQ |
MethoCult® |
Growth Factor/Cytokine Cocktail |
| KC-GEM2-50H |
K4-PCA1-1,2,4* |
H4434 |
EPO, GM-CSF, IL-3, SCF |
| KC-GEM3-50H |
K4-PCA2-1,2,4* |
H4034 |
EPO, GM-CSF, G-CSF, IL-3, SCF |
| K2-GM1-50H |
K4-PCA3-1,2,4* |
H4534 |
GM-CSF, IL-3, SCF |
| KC-GM2-50H |
K4-PCA4-1,2,4* |
H4035 |
GM-CSF, G-CSF, IL-3, SCF |
*denotes that assay kits are available with 1, 2 or 4, 96-well plates

Individual Cell Populations Detected
- GM-CFC to predict neutrophil engraftment
- Mk-CFC to predict platelet engraftment
- BFU-E to predict red blood cell engraftment
Multiple Lineages for "Global" Hematopoietic Reconstitution
- HPP-SP, primitive stem cell
- CFC-GEMM, hematopoietic stem cell
- GM-CFC, myelomonocytic lineage
- BFU-E, erythropoietic lineage
- Mk-CFC, megakaryopoietic lineage
